The National Park of Ordesa y Monte Perdido is located within the Aragonese Pyrenees and is one of the main highlights of the area. It was in fact one of the world's first national parks, created in 1918. Today, it's a magical place to visit, filled with soaring peaks, glacial lakes, cascading waterfalls and all manner of flora and fauna.

The Ordesa y Monte Perdido National Park was declared a World Heritage Site in 1997. It is located within the Ordesa-Viñamala Biosphere Reserve in the Pyrenees of the province of Huesca in Aragon, Spain. The park is the first protected area in Spain and is considered the most important national park in Spain. What makes this space so attractive is the beauty of its surroundings.

Camping in the Ordesa National Park. From 2022, trekkers will no longer be able to camp near to the Góriz hostel or anywhere nearby. Last year there were up to 200 tents with consequent problems for the sewerage system. If the hostel is full, and only if all beds are taken, exceptionally up to 50 tents may be tolerated, but camping won't be.

Introduction to Ordesa and Monte Perdido National Park History and Origin of the National Park. The Ordesa and Monte Perdido National Park was established in 1918 and is the second oldest national park in Spain. Originally, it only included the Ordesa Valley, but in 1982 it was expanded to also cover the Monte Perdido massif.
